WebDefinition and Usage. The animation-timing-function specifies the speed curve of an animation. The speed curve defines the TIME an animation uses to change from one set of CSS styles to another. The speed curve is used to make the changes smoothly. Default … WebAn animation lets an element gradually change from one style to another. You can change as many CSS properties you want, as many times as you want. To use CSS animation, you must first specify some keyframes for the animation. Keyframes hold what styles the element will have at certain times.

For one, you can animate CSS properties with … WebThe font-size property isn’t optimized for animations, and the jump between font sizes is not something that animates well. This is especially true when dealing with fonts that are finicky about their font size. One thing to clarify: animating the transform will only make your text scale performantly. It won't solve the weird display issues.
